What has the author Ken T Taylor written?

Ken T. Taylor has written: 'The registers of Leigh Parish Church, 1701-1753' -- subject(s): Astley Chapel (Leigh, Lancashire, England), Atherton Chapel (Leigh, Lancashire, England), Church records and registers, Genealogy, Leigh (Lancashire, England : Parish), Registers, St. Mary the Virgin (Church : Leigh, Lancashire, England) 'The registers of St. Luke, Lowton, 1733-1837' -- subject(s): Church records and registers, Registers, Registers of births, Genealogy, St. Luke (Church : Lowton, England)

When was Geoffrey Unsworth born?

Geoffrey Unsworth was born in 1914, in Leigh, Lancashire, England, UK.
